Born: 29 May 1823 in Baie-Saint-Paul, Lower Canada



Spouse(s)/Partner(s) and Child(ren):

Angele  married  Thadee TREMBLAY 13 January 1846 in Saint-Urbain, Charlevoix, Canada East .  The couple had (at least) 5 children.
Thadee TREMBLAY  was born 30 June 1823 in Baie-Saint-Paul, Québec, Canada (Saint-Pierre-et-Saint-Paul-de-Baie-Saint-Paul).  Thadee died 27 December 1915 in Baie-Saint-Paul, Québec, Canada (Saint-Pierre-et-Saint-Paul-de-Baie-Saint-Paul).  Thadee was the child of Augustin TREMBLAY and Marie-Anne BOIVIN.

Angele FORTIN died 16 December 1911 in Baie-Saint-Paul, Québec, Canada .

Did You Know? Québec Généalogie - Over time, Québec has gone through a series of name changes
From its inception in the early 1600s until 1760, it was called Canada, New France.
1760 to 1763, it was simply Canada
1763 to 1791 - Province of Québec
1791 to 1867 - Lower Canada
1867 to present - Québec, Canada.
